A marine electrician is a specialized professional who installs, maintains, and repairs electrical systems on ships, boats, and other marine vessels. They are responsible for ensuring that all electrical equipment on board is functioning properly and safely. This includes wiring, lighting systems, communication systems, navigation equipment, and power generation systems. Marine electricians may also be involved in troubleshooting electrical issues, performing inspections, and upgrading or replacing outdated or faulty equipment.

Marine Electrician salary in Oman
Average Yearly Salary of Marine Electrician in Oman is approximately 22,294 OMR (9,340 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Oman, officially known as the Sultanate of Oman, is a country located in the southeastern coast of the Arabian Peninsula. With a population of around 5 million people, it spans an area of approximately 309,500 square kilometers. Oman is bordered by the United Arab Emirates to the northwest, Saudi Arabia to the west, and Yemen to the southwest.
